Go language, also known as Golang, is a programming language developed by Google. It debuted in 2007 and was officially released in 2012, and quickly gained popularity among programmers. The Go language is designed as a programming language for large-scale system development, with features such as fast compilation, efficient execution, and concurrency support. Compared with mainstream languages, the syntax of Go language is concise and clear, easy to learn and understand. It integrates the advanced features of modern programming languages ​​and has become the first choice of more and more developers.

First, let’s take a look at the comparison between Go language and mainstream languages. Take C as an example. C is a programming language with a long history and is widely used in system development, game development and other fields. However, C's syntax is complex, error-prone, and requires third-party library support when dealing with concurrent programming. In contrast, the Go language has built-in concurrency support. Concurrent programming can be easily implemented using Go coroutines, and the code is clearer and more concise. The following is a simple concurrent programming example:

package main

import (
    "fmt"
    "time"
)

func printNumbers() {
    for i := 1; i <= 5; i++ {
        time.Sleep(1 * time.Second)
        fmt.Println(i)
    }
}

func main() {
    go printNumbers()
    fmt.Println("Printing numbers in background...")
    time.Sleep(6 * time.Second)
}

In this code, a new Go coroutine is created by go printNumbers() to print numbers in the background, while the main program execution will continue. This concurrency model makes the Go language outstanding in handling high-concurrency scenarios.

In addition, the Go language also has excellent performance. Compared with Java, the Go language compiles faster and executes more efficiently. The garbage collection mechanism of the Go language is also better than that of traditional languages, and can effectively manage memory and reduce the risk of memory leaks. The following is a simple performance test example:

package main

import (
    "fmt"
    "time"
)

func fibonacci(n int) int {
    if n <= 1 {
        return n
    }
    return fibonacci(n-1) + fibonacci(n-2)
}

func main() {
    start := time.Now()
    fmt.Println(fibonacci(40))
    fmt.Printf("Time taken: %v
", time.Since(start))
}

With the above code, we can quickly calculate the 40th number of the Fibonacci sequence and record the time spent on the calculation. In performance tests, the Go language usually performs well and has excellent computational efficiency.

In general, the status of Go language in the field of programming is gradually increasing, challenging the status of mainstream languages. Its simplicity, efficiency, and concurrency support give it broad application prospects in cloud computing, big data, distributed systems and other fields. Of course, the Go language also faces many challenges, such as a relatively incomplete ecosystem and relatively few library supports.
